首页 > 文章列表 > PHP实现实时病房管理系统技术综述

PHP实现实时病房管理系统技术综述

php 实时更新 病房管理
332 2023-06-28

随着医疗技术的不断发展和提高,病房管理系统已成为医院管理中不可或缺的一项技术。其中,PHP作为一门主要用于Web开发的脚本语言,已经成为许多病房管理系统的技术选择之一。本文将对PHP实现实时病房管理系统的技术进行综述。

  1. PHP技术概述

1.1 PHP的基本概念

PHP(Hypertext Preprocessor)是一种在服务器端执行的脚本语言,最早由RasmusLerdorf 开发。它可以用来开发 Web 应用程序,比如动态网站和 Web 应用程序。PHP能够与很多数据库进行连接,如MySQL、Oracle和 PostgreSQL等,以及开源软件Apache的服务器端。在Web服务器端解释PHP脚本的时候,会生成HTML文本并将其发送到客户端的浏览器来显示。

1.2 PHP的特点

PHP是一种解释型脚本语言,它可以直接嵌入到HTML中,具有代码简单、易学易用、支持多种数据库、跨平台等特点。此外,PHP还支持面向对象编程,以及在命令行下运行。

  1. 实时病房管理系统技术综述

2.1 实时病房管理系统的需求分析

病房管理是一个非常重要的环节,对医院日常工作的顺利开展起到了至关重要的作用。一个可行的实时病房管理系统应该包括以下内容:

(1)患者信息管理(如患者姓名、住院号、床位号、科室等)。

(2)护理记录管理(如患者的护理情况、药物使用情况等)。

(3)医嘱管理(如患者的用药情况、主治医生、检验项目等)。

(4)病房设备管理(如床位、呼叫器、手术灯等)。

(5)实时监控病人身体情况。

2.2 实时病房管理系统的技术实现

在实现病房管理系统时,需要使用到HTML、CSS、JavaScript、PHP等技术,其中PHP是实现后台数据处理的重要工具。

2.2.1 建立数据库

建立数据库的第一步是创建一个新的数据库。MySQL是一个常见的数据库管理系统(DBMS),非常适合PHP网站的集成。

2.2.2 PHP连接MySQL数据库

接着使用PHP进行数据库连接并进行增删改查等操作。连接数据库需要使用以下语法:

$con=mysqli_connect("localhost","用户名","密码","数据库名");

其中 localhost 是 MySQL 服务器主机名,用户名和密码是 MySQL 的登陆信息,数据库名是具体的数据库名称。连接建立后,我们可以对数据库进行各种操作。

2.2.3 统计病人信息

使用PHP开发后台程序来实现和管理病人信息。可以设置增加、删除、修改病人信息等功能。例如,可以使用一个函数来处理增加病人信息的请求:

functionadd_patient($cname,$csex,$cage,$cward,$cbed)

{

global$con;

$sql="insert intopatient(name,sex,age,ward,bed) values('$cname','$csex',$cage,'$cward','$cbed')";

mysqli_query($con,$sql);

}

这个函数使用 SQL INSERT 语句将患者的名称、性别、年龄、诊所和病床号添加到 patient 表中。

2.2.4 实时监测患者身体情况

为实现监测病人身体情况的功能,需要使用嵌入式系统,采集患者的生理信息并交给PHP进行处理。可以使用Python或C++等语言通过物联网连接传感器并定期向后端传入数据,PHP后台程序会根据接收到的数据在前端显示。

  1. 结论

在本文中,我们综述了PHP实现实时病房管理系统的技术,并对其进行了详细的说明。PHP作为一种功能丰富、容易使用的Web开发语言,在实现病房管理系统时表现出色。虽然病房管理系统需要考虑许多问题,但是使用PHP可以让这一过程变得更加高效、稳定、可靠。